2. Step-by-Step Guide to Getting Your Irish Driving License
Securing a complete Irish driving license needs patience and adherence to a rigorous chronological procedure. Here is how it works:
Step 1: Pass the Driver Theory Test (DTT)
Before requesting a learner authorization, prospects need to pass a computer-based theory test.
What it covers: Rules of the road, road signs, danger awareness, and driving habits.Preparation: Candidates must study the main Rules of the Road book and use licensed online practice websites.Step 2: Apply for Your Learner Permit
Once the theory test is effectively finished, the applicant can apply for a Learner Permit through the NDLS.
Requirements: A passing theory test certificate, evidence of identity, proof of address, proof of PPSN, and a completed vision report form (if suitable).Action 3: Complete Essential Driver Training (EDT)
For Category B (vehicle) students, finishing Essential Driver Training (EDT) is a mandatory legal requirement.
Structure: The program consists of 12 one-hour lessons delivered by an Approved Driving Instructor (ADI).Logbook: Each lesson is tape-recorded in an official logbook, and learners should permit at least 6 months from the date of their very first authorization problem before they are legally permitted to sit the driving test.Step 4: Practice and Prepare
In addition to formal EDT lessons, learners are highly motivated to get as much useful driving experience as possible with a sponsor (an individual who has held a complete driving license for a minimum of 2 years). During this phase, student motorists should screen L-plates on the front and back of the automobile at all times and are strictly forbidden from driving on motorways.
Step 5: Pass the Driving Test
When confident and qualified, candidates can schedule their practical driving test by means of the RSA site. The test examines lorry safety understanding, technical driving capability, hazard understanding, and general roadway rules.
Action 6: Apply for the Full License
Upon passing the dry run, the examiner will issue a Certificate of Competency. This certificate, together with supporting files and a charge, is sent to the NDLS to receive the main full driving license.

If you already hold a driving license from another nation, you might not require to start from scratch. Ireland has reciprocal agreements with different countries, dividing foreign licenses into specific groups:
EU/EEA Member States: If your license was released by an EU or EEA country, you can drive in Ireland on your existing license up until it ends. You can likewise exchange it for an Irish license without taking a test.Acknowledged States: Countries such as Australia, Canada, New Zealand, South Africa, and Taiwan have agreements that permit the direct exchange of particular license categories.Other Countries: Individuals with licenses from non-recognized countries should go through the basic [Irish Driver License](https://www.dekorofisemlak.com/agent/driving-license-ie8567/) process, starting with the Driver Theory Test and the EDT program.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. 2. Can I drive on Irish motorways with a Learner Permit?
No. Student license holders are strictly forbidden from driving on Irish motorways. Doing so can lead to charge points, heavy fines, and the possible impoundment of the automobile.
3. What documents do I require to give my NDLS visit?
When going to an NDLS center personally, you usually require to bring:
A finished application (signed and stamped where necessary).Your existing license or license (if relevant).Proof of your Personal Public Service Number (PPSN).Evidence of address (dated within the last 6 months).Evidence of identity (e.g., a valid passport).An eyesight report type (if required for your classification).4. How much does it cost to get a full driving license in Ireland?
Expenses can differ depending on individual scenarios, but standard fees usually consist of:
Driver Theory Test: EUR45Learner Permit Application: EUR35EDT Lessons: Varies by trainer (generally EUR40-- EUR60 per lesson)Driving Test Fee: EUR85 (standard automobile)Full License Fee: EUR55 (10-year validity)5. Do I need to show any particular signs on my car as a brand-new motorist?
Yes. If you hold a Learner Permit, you need to display red L-plates on a white background on both the front and rear of your vehicle. As soon as you pass your test and get your full license, you are lawfully required to show green N-plates (Novice plates) for the first two years of your driving profession.
